Beyond Break-Fix: A Proactive Approach to IT Support
In today's dynamic technological landscape, organizations need a shift in their approach to IT support. The traditional "break-fix" model, where problems are addressed only after they occur, is no longer adequate. A proactive methodology that foresees potential issues and implements preventative measures is vital for ensuring smooth operations and maximizing IT infrastructure uptime.
- Utilizing robust monitoring tools to detect performance bottlenecks and potential issues before they become critical.
- Periodically updating software and hardware to mitigate security vulnerabilities and enhance system stability.
- Executing scheduled maintenance tasks to guarantee optimal performance and prevent disruptions.
By adopting a proactive IT support strategy, organizations can enhance their operational efficiency, decrease costs associated with emergency repairs, and consequently create a more reliable and resilient IT environment.
